Janice Louise Gira

July 20, 1943 — March 14, 2025

Janice Gira, 81, Dilworth, MN died Friday March 14, 2025 at Lilac Homes under the care of Hospice and surrounded by her family.

Janice Louise Kern was born July 20, 1943, to Melvin and Marian Kern in Wadena, MN. She went to District 15 country school and graduated from Wadena High in 1961. Janice was a member of Wadena Junior 4-H Club where she showed cattle at the Wadena County Fair and Minnesota State Fair. She won many ribbons for her Golden Guernsey cows and received the 4-H Key Award in 1961.

Janice attended Interstate Business College in Fargo where she graduated with a degree in accounting and business law. She worked as a nanny while attending college and later at Border States Electric.

She met the love of her life, Charles Gira, on February 14, 1969. They married on September 20, 1969 and made their home in Fargo with their two children, David and Mary.

Janice was very active in Boy Scouts as a den leader and Scoutmaster and Girl Scouts as a leader and North Fargo Service Chair. She was also active in PTA.

Janice helped start the Adopt-A-Street project after meeting with Dennis Walaker (Fargo Mayor) and the Fargo Street Department about cleaning the roadsides in Fargo. Janice and Charles cleaned 19th Ave N for over 25 years.

Janice and Charles loved to fish and camp and had a seasonal spot on Twin and Rose Lakes for many years. She loved being outdoors working, especially blowing snow and helping her neighbors with their driveways and sidewalks. She proudly attended every event for her children from school programs to swimming, dance, and later for her grandchildren who were involved in wrestling, volleyball, hockey, tennis and dance.
